Bills' Damar Hamlin wanted to help his community, now NFL fans are doing it in his honor

Shortly after finishing his football career at the University of Pittsburgh, Damar Hamlin made plans to give back to the community where he grew up. He organized a holiday toy drive to benefit his mom’s daycare center in McKees Rock, Pennsylvania, and set up a GoFundMe page to solicit donations.

“As I embark on my journey to the NFL, I will never forget where I come from,” Hamlin wrote months before the Buffalo Bills selected him in the sixth round of the 2021 draft. “I am committed to using my platform to positively impact the community that raised me.
